Ireland announced that it would boycott Eurovision 2026 “If the participation of Israel continues.”

Irish broadcasting organization RTé He made a statement, saying that in EBU, the organizers of the Eurovision Song Contest in July, “several EBU members expressed concern about Israeli participation in the Eurovision Song Contest.”

The statement states: “RTé position will not participate in the Eurovision Song Contest 2026, if Israel’s participation will continue, and the final decision on the participation of Ireland will be made as soon as the EBU decision is made.”

The organization added: “Rté believes that the participation of Ireland will be unmistakable, given the constant and terrible loss of life in gas. RTé is also deeply concerned about the purposeful murder of journalists in Gaza, refusing to access international journalists to the region and the state of the remaining hostages. ”

Intention to also leave the Netherlands

And the Netherlands, after Ireland, announced that it would not participate in the Eurovision Service competition of 2026 if Israel takes part in this event from the scale of suffering in gas, the Dutch broadcasting network Avrotros said.

The latest Eurovision competitions were overshadowed by protest events to participate in Israel in the Israeli war in Gaza.

The Avrotros network announced that in its decision to boycott the 2026 competition, it also took into account a large number of journalists killed in Gaza.

The European Broadcasting Union (EBU), organizing competition, announced that he understands “problems and beliefs of the developing war in the Middle East.”

“We continue our consultations with EBU members in order to collect views on how we control the participation of the Eurovision and Geopolitical Strength Song Contest.”

This is followed by the comments of the Spanish Minister of Culture of Ernest about the participation of Spain in Eurovision next year.

Earlier this week, Euronews Culture reported that Spain also threatened to leave competition if Israel remains in the programThe field “I don’t think that we can normalize Israeli participation in international events, as if nothing had happened,” Urnsan said during an interview with the La Hora de la 1 show on TV. “He is not an individual artist, but one who participates on behalf of the citizens of this country.”

EBU extended the deadline for removal without a sentence by December, when the final decision is expected to participate in Israel in the General Assembly. The 70th Eurovision should take place in Vienna, Austria. The final will be held on May 16 after the semifinals on May 12 and 14, 2026.
